Degotte is an expert in flexible buildings. The company, with locations in Belgium and Luxembourg, specializes in modular buildings and offers space solutions for schools and government offices, as well as supermarket chains and the medical sector. Based on a standardized container construction method, Degotte develops customized, even multi-story, solutions that perfectly meet the individual space requirements of its clients. And their clients appreciate this.
Due to consistent market growth, Degotte had to adjust its production capacity. "The customer urgently needed to expand its storage capacity," explains Suzy Kameni, the project manager. To continue offering its customers the same high-quality service, the company quickly required additional warehouse space in the Liège region. Degotte opted for a lightweight, modular building from Herchenbach at its site in Herstal, Belgium.
Lightweight cold storage building
Whether for material storage, logistics, vehicle shelter, or hangar: the Safe+ lightweight building is versatile. The company Degotte uses the unheated building to store materials for its mobile buildings in a weatherproof and theft-proof manner. The large opening, which can be closed with a sliding gate, allows for easy access to the building.
The building and its fittings were adapted to the specific characteristics of the site without compromising its quality or limiting its potential uses. We were able to quickly meet the client's needs. Just five weeks elapsed between the site inspection, the technical clarifications, and the delivery of the building.
Safety through pre-assembly inspection
Additional services can be flexibly added to the "full-service package".
We faced several challenges. A sloping site, pull-out test results indicating difficult anchoring, and a long side that was only accessible on one side,” says the project manager. The company was impressed not only by the flexible product, which could be precisely adapted to the warehouse's needs, but also by Herchenbach's specialization in industrial buildings and their fast, customer-focused service.
Degotte added the pre-assembly inspection to their full-service package. This provides the customer with assurance that the ground is suitable for the cost-effective ground anchoring system. Ground anchoring saves approximately €100,000 and four weeks of construction time because no foundation needs to be poured. "We were able to quickly meet the customer's needs," says Suzy Kameni.
During the planning phase, it also became apparent that the slope needed to be leveled. The aluminum profiles used can be easily adapted to the local conditions by shortening them. Any unused material can be completely recycled. If the building is no longer needed at this location, the individual components are also almost 100% reusable. This aligns perfectly with a company like Degotte, for whom sustainability and environmental awareness are paramount.
